Ruclers Lane Park
Ruclers Lane Park is a playground in Kings Langley, Dacorum District, England. Ruclers Lane Park is situated nearby to the forest Barnes Lodge, as well as near the sports venue Inspired Fitness Centre.Places of Interest Nearby

Apsley
Suburb
Photo: PAUL FARMER, CC BY-SA 2.0.
Apsley is a village in Hertfordshire, England, in a valley of the Chiltern Hills below the confluence of the River Gade and Bulbourne. It was the site of water mills serving local agriculture and from the early 19th century became an important centre for papermaking.
